Mr Neil Patel

Consultant Orthopaedic Surgeon

  • Department: Orthopaedics
  • Speciality: Orthopaedics
  • Based at Hospital site: Darlington Memorial Hospital
  • Special interests: Upper limb surgery
  • Secretary: Jan Mcdonagh
  • Training: Undergraduate at Kings College London; Orthopaedic training, West Yorkshire training programme, Upper Limb Fellowships at Cambridge, Derby (including the Pulvertaft Unit) and Leeds.
  • Qualifications: MBBS (Lond), FRCS (Glasg), FRCS (T+O), MSc Dip SEM, MFSEM (UK +I)
  • Date added to the specialist register: December 2009
  • Training role: Tutor and examiner for MSc Sports and Exercise Medicine course, University of Bath.
